Market Position and Competitive Landscape

Unity Engine positions itself as a leading real-time 3D platform, competing with Unreal and emerging tools in specific verticals. Its flexible licensing and broad device support help maintain strong adoption metrics.

Analysts track ARR, churn, and platform stickiness to estimate Unity’s ongoing market value. Strategic acquisitions and partnerships further shape its long-term valuation trajectory.

Monetization and Subscription Models

Revenue streams include runtime fees, Unity Asset Store commissions, and enterprise subscriptions. Over time, shifts in pricing and royalty rules have influenced developer sentiment and revenue predictability.

Subscription tiers such as Unity Pro and Enterprise stabilize cash flow while offering advanced services. This model supports a more predictable net worth compared to one-time license sales.

Platform Strategy and Ecosystem Expansion

Unity’s push beyond gaming into automotive, film, and spatial computing expands its addressable market. Cross-platform toolchains and cloud services increase integration depth for partners.

Investments in services like Unity Ads and Unity Recover help diversify income. A robust ecosystem of creators and studios reinforces the long-term value of the platform.

Technical Roadmap and Innovation Focus

Ongoing development of the Data-Oriented Technology Stack (DOTS) and high-fidelity graphics features targets performance-conscious teams. Real-time collaboration and enhanced tooling aim to streamline production pipelines.

Investments in AI-assisted content creation and edge deployment keep Unity competitive. These innovations contribute to perceived product value and influence net worth assessments.
